The Ministry of Finance of Japan and the Bank of Thailand signed the Memorandum of Cooperation for the Establishment of a Framework for Cooperation to Promote the Use of Local Currencies. The authorities of both countries reached mutual agreement on initiatives relating to the promotion of the use of local currencies for trade and investment settlement, which includes, among others, promotion of the direct exchange rate quotation and interbank trading between the Japanese Yen and the Thai Baht.
